Suicide prevention – the role of psychiatry
Ethics, Professionalism, Suicide
Suicide remains one of the leading causes of preventable death in Australia and Aotearoa New Zealand, with far-reaching effects on families, whānau, and communities. Psychiatrists play a central role in suicide prevention by providing clinical expertise, leadership, and advocacy within multidisciplinary systems of care. Suicide prevention requires sustained effort and coordination across governments, health and social systems, communities, and individuals. The Royal Australian and New Zealand College of Psychiatrists (RANZCP) advocates for compassionate, evidence-based, culturally safe and person-centred approaches to prevention, intervention, and postvention, underpinned by collaboration, equity, and kindness.

Submission to the state audit of the Infant, Child and Adolescent Mental Health System Transformation Program
In this submission, the Branch focused on issues in governance and planning of infant, child and adolescent mental healthcare, including critical lack of suitable workforce, lack of clarity of the mental health system manager role, slow progress in service integration and development of planned services, and critical gaps in the service system.
